Latest Patents

Among his latest innovations are two significant patents related to arthroscopic devices. The first patent describes a resecting probe featuring a shaft assembly with both an outer and an inner sleeve. This design includes an axial bore, an outer window on the distal side of the outer sleeve, and a rotationally disposed inner sleeve with an extraction channel. This configuration allows for the alignment and misalignment of cutting windows, facilitating fluid flow and cooling during procedures.

The second patent details an arthroscopic cutter that consists of an elongated outer sleeve with a distal opening. The inner sleeve rotates within the outer sleeve and features a unique housing composed of a metal member and a ceramic member. This design not only provides a channel that communicates with a negative pressure source but also integrates an electrode for advanced cutting functions, which significantly enhances operational efficiency in arthroscopic procedures.
